Transaction 597501ee7f87370ea8d7170e4fa7c9e10279ec2c0bf9f771b0ada073e24011a2
1 Input
1 Output
-
597501ee7f87370ea8d7170e4fa7c9e10279ec2c0bf9f771b0ada073e24011a2:0
- value
- 25152120
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 164d15c05f7b6a3daec40eb27c42d875bee932c7 OP_EQUAL
- address
- 33iw8io3aaCzVb4oEMxk8LCbF5XAQ7QmDD